CALOGRAMS.

(EltTTBR's SPBCIAL TO PbBSS AfIBNCT.)

London, August 23.

At the wool sales to-day 9,500 bales wire catalogued. The tone of the market is quieter.

The total quantity of wheat afloat for Great Britan is 1,820,000 quarters. \M.- -'. f ;/ /ViENMk/AugJßst 25.

An official statement by the AustroHungarian Government estimates the deficiency in the Empire' in the wheat crop to be 9,250,000 centals; rye 7,250,000 centals.!; ■*■'■'" ' ■■ ■■-■'■ ■■ ■■ ■■■ ■>■■■■■;
